    Choosing an Online Psychiatrist

    You should only look at online psychiatry services that have low costs. You should also determine if the service accepts your insurance.

    Some online psychiatry services offer appointments via text or video chat. Some allow you to make appointments by phone or computer. They can also call your GP to request medical investigations such as blood tests.

    Accessibility

    You should select an online psychiatrist that offers different appointment times. This is especially beneficial when trying to make an appointment outside of normal business hours. Be sure that the app or website offers clear and simple cost information. It is also crucial to select a service which allows you to switch if you’re not happy with the service.

    Another benefit of having an online psychiatrist is that they can offer treatment for a variety of mental health issues, including bipolar disorder, depression, eating disorders, and anxiety. In fact, some online psychiatrists specialize in treating these disorders. This is because these professionals have the knowledge and experience to identify and treat these ailments. As medical doctors they are able to prescribe medication.

    Telepsychiatry also has the ability to provide mental health services to areas that are underserved. According to the Agency for Healthcare Research and Quality, one in eight emergency room visits is related to an issue with psychiatry. Unfortunately, many emergency rooms do not have a psychiatrist available to assist these patients. Telepsychiatry can help address this problem by connecting patients via teleconference to a psychiatrist.

    Contrary to therapists who aren’t medically qualified, psychiatrists can prescribe medication. Not all telehealth platforms permit psychiatrists to prescribe certain types medications, including stimulants or controlled drugs. However, a number of telehealth platforms are working to solve this issue by expanding their list of psychiatrists who can provide these services.

    When selecting an online psychiatry clinic, you should check their credentials to make sure they’re licensed. You should also be aware of any charges, such as the copay or deductible. It is also advisable to inquire with your insurance company about coverage options for online services.

    Most online psychiatry services can accept insurance, and a lot offer a sliding fee scale for those who do not have insurance. Many of these services are accessible through mobile devices, making it easy to access them from anywhere.

    Scheduling is easy

    Telepsychiatry, also known as online psychiatry, allows patients to connect with licensed psychiatrists and psychiatric nurse practitioners via videoconferencing. These appointments can help patients cope with mental issues such as depression, anxiety, and bipolar disorder. The services offered by these professionals include private psychiatric assessment cost assessments, individual and family sessions for therapy, as well as medication management. In addition to providing access to mental health services These services are usually less expensive than in-person visits. In certain instances the services could be covered by insurance.

    Telepsychiatry is an excellent option for those who are uncomfortable with video calls. Many health professionals and psychiatrists have worked with patients who struggle or are hesitant to open up in person. Video communication can help patients feel more comfortable and build trust. The technology also allows for more flexible schedules, which is essential for patients who are unable to travel or work during the day.

    When choosing a telepsychiatry service be sure to choose one that offers a wide variety of appointment times. It is also important to consider whether the service you select will be available to meet with you on a regular basis and in person should you prefer that. Also look for a provider that allows you to switch to a different service in the event that you aren’t satisfied with the first one you choose.

    If you’re planning to use your insurance, be certain to verify that the online psychiatry services you’re looking at is in-network with your insurance provider. You might have to pay a higher cost or even a copay if you do not.

    The best online psychiatry providers offer accessibility (through wider insurance networks or more affordable payment plans) as well as ease-of-use and navigation, and an excellent network of compassionate and skilled psychiatric professionals from which you can choose. Teladoc for instance, has over 20 years of experience and can provide psychiatry and other medical specialties via a user-friendly and simple platform. This telehealth service is HIPAA certified and provides a secure messaging system for notes after visits or follow-ups. The cost per visit without insurance is among the lowest of our reviews.

    Online Psychiatry: How It Works

    When you book an appointment with Talkspace, you will speak with a licensed nurse practitioner or psychiatrist via video chat. During the initial appointment they’ll ask standard questions about your symptoms as well as medical background. They’ll also talk about your current medication and how you are experiencing it. Then they’ll recommend a treatment plan, including prescription medication (unless you’re dealing with controlled substances, which are not legal to prescribe on the Internet).

    Once your consultation is complete After your consultation is completed, your doctor will send you a prescription by text or email. You can visit your usual pharmacy to pick up your prescription, or you can choose to have it delivered directly to your home. If you are covered by health insurance, your company will file your claim on your behalf. If you’re paying out through your pocket, you may use your credit card, PayPal account, or a health savings or flexible spending account.
